haha man dont worry about what people say about supplements. I take amny supplements because its vital to my training, but if your not eating right and working out your wasting money. If you trying to gain muscle, just get a tub of gold standard protein, take in 2 grams of protein per body lb.

do not lift everyday. make a rotation of body parts. go to bodybuilding.com for workouts.

another supp. to help gain mass is creatine, there have been no side effects found from it and my dr. reccomends it. 1 scoop on not lifting days, 2 on lifting days one morning, one after workout

if you are cutting weight the best supp. for that would be meltdown by vpx, I use this to cut weight before my fights, very good thermogenic and has a dose of a "feel good" stimulant that is found in chocalate.

remember supplements do just as they say, they are supplemental to a good workout regimen and clean diet. no not that bs hollywood diet, I mean the eat clean white meats and green veggies and fruits. try eating more when your gaining muscle. if cutting weight then its simple calorie intake should be lower than calories burnt throughout the day.

Also take some a multi-vitamin and some fish oil, it has awesome benefits.
